Contractors visiting Meridale House for interviews will use the secure room on level 3, adjacent to the east stairwell. Please sign in at reception, wear your visitor lanyard visibly, and do not bring recording devices inside. The room is kept locked between sessions for confidentiality. To enter at your scheduled time, use the door code provided below.

staff pass of kawip-hawef = bdg-QLP-2

### Postmortem Timeline — Planner Regression (Quartzel DB)

14:02 — Dashboards showed p95 query latency tripling on the Loomis cluster. 14:10 — On-call confirmed the new cost model in the planner was preferring nested-loop joins on large tables. 14:25 — Feature flag `planner_costs_v3` disabled; latency recovered within four minutes. 14:40 — Rollback of the planner package scheduled for all clusters. For new team members: the flag gates everything, so disabling it is always the first move. The offending build is recorded below.

session token of yajof-bagef = htk4_937d

**Mgmt Meeting Minutes — Retiring the Brightline Range**

Quick recap for sales leads at Fenholt Supplies: we agreed to retire the Brightline fixture range by year-end. Remaining stock moves to clearance pricing next month, and accounts on standing orders get migrated to the Lumetta range. Trade-in incentives were approved in principle. The confidential note on next steps sits just below.

board note of bajof-bajeg: The pricing group signed off on a budget of $13.4 million for Project Sildor. The renewal with Lamixek Holdings closes at $48.9 million a year, 49 percent above the last contract.

Subject: DR drill — InvoiceForge renderer, Thursday

Welcome aboard. Thursday's drill simulates total loss of the InvoiceForge PDF rendering cluster in the Dunmere region. Your role: restore the renderer from the cold snapshot, verify font embedding, and confirm a test invoice renders identically to the golden copy. You'll need access to the sealed restore account, which stays dormant outside drills. Do not reset it; doing so invalidates the escrow. The account's recovery passphrase is recorded below.

vault phrase of kajop-kaweg = sorix-istys-noviel